Republican Primary Elections, Nikki Haley defeat Trump in Washington DC

Republican presidential candidate Nikki Haley defeated former US President Donald Trump in the Republican primary in Washington, DC.

Foreign media reports that Nikki Haley won her first victory over former President Trump in Washington, DC during her 2024 campaign to become the Republican presidential nominee.

Despite becoming the first female US president, Nikki lost to Donald Trump in her home state of South Carolina.

But Trump easily leads Haley in the race and is likely to face Joe Biden in the upcoming presidential election in November.

In contrast to Trump’s 33.2 percent of the vote, Haley, the former US ambassador to the United Nations, received 62.9 percent.

The Washington Post reports that 2,035 Republicans participated in the primary, according to local party officials.
